U.S.NAVY SUBMARINE JACKET Size:44 After the Second World WarThe U. S. NAVY SUBMARINE JACKET, formally known as the Coat, Winter, Woolen, was a wool coat issued specifically to U. S. Navy submarine personnel who were considered an elite unit within the Navy. Designed for use in the confined, cold environments aboard submarines, it emphasized functionality and mobility, while also serving as a symbol of distinction from other naval divisions.
